This is not the time to sit back


Let's get the bad news out of the way. Credit is going to get harder over the next few years. When a housing bubble bursts and banks tremble, the first thing that happens is money gets tight. Go back even a few months and the banks might have been encouraging you to borrow some more. Now they are writing you letters to think about paying some back. So, if what was easy is now going to be hard, you need to defend your interests. The first step is to get a free credit check. Most everyone that has an interest in you takes a look at your credit history. It can be your bank or credit card company, your insurance providers, your mortgagee or landlord. That means it better be correct in every last detail. Since all these people have their own formulas for calculating a credit score for you, the raw data must be right to give you the best possible score.

There are three credit bureaus that act as clearinghouses and set out to collect all the consumer credit information about you. They are Equifax, TransUnion and Experian. In the good old days, they used to charge for a copy of your credit report. Following the Fair and Accurate Credit Transactions Act of 2003 (FACTA), you have the right to get one free report per year from each of the three companies. More importantly, you have the right to have the companies correct any mistakes. It can be so easy for someone to register you as being in debt and then forget to show you paid it off. Find a mistake in one company and the other two must also correct their credit files. That way, you repair your creditworthiness.

Just as important is credit risk management. This is where you monitor your reports to ensure that no-one else is impersonating you. Identify fraud is a growing problem. If you travel around a lot or have multiple accounts, it can be worth paying a company to verify the transactions. The early you detect any abuse of your credit cards, the sooner you can put defensive measures in place. Say you go away on holiday. A common fraud is for someone to note your card number and then put through big ticket transactions before you get home. If you're using credit check services, all suspicious payments are picked up immediately and your card cancelled instead of leaving everything as an unwelcome surprise for you when you get home.
